392 Drainage Ditches General Information
| 392 Drainage Ditches General Information |
| Although many ditches throughout Lucas County are
called county or township ditches and are shown in the
records of the County Engineer, there are no funds provided by the state or county to improve or maintain these ditches. The county does not have ecisements or right of way established along ditches which cross private property. In most cases, any work that is preformed must be initiated by petition from the property owners and paid for through assessments.
An exception is the maintenance of roadside ditches along the 300 mile county road system where road funding may be used to protect the pavement and roadway from flooding. Please remember, this maintenance is only on the county road system because the County Engineer does not maintain any storm drainage ditches or sewers along township, city or village roads and streets.
